Abstract
Claims
1. A multi-station rotary PCB separator, mainly characterized in that: the PCB separator is equipped with a divider, the divider is equipped with a turret, the turret is surrounded by four hollowed-out and equally spaced jig rotating modules, the jig rotating modules can be used to place the circuit board to be cut, the divider synchronously rotates the four jig rotating modules to form four stations that can operate simultaneously, the first station is the feeding module, the second and third stations are the milling modules, and the fourth station is the discharging module.
2. The multi-station rotary PCB separator as described in claim 1, wherein: The milling modules at stations two and three are both top-cutting milling modules. Each top-cutting milling module is equipped with a fixture pressure plate module and a transfer module. The circuit board is first pressed onto the fixture rotation module at stations two and three using the fixture pressure plate module, and then the circuit board is milled from top to bottom using the top-cutting milling module.
3. The multi-station rotary PCB separator as described in claim 1, wherein: The second and third stations have two milling modules: one is an upper milling module, and the other is a lower milling module. The upper milling module is equipped with a fixture pressure plate module and a transfer module. The circuit board is first pressed onto the fixture rotation module of the second station using the fixture pressure plate module, and then the circuit board is milled from top to bottom using the upper milling module. The lower milling module is equipped with a fixture pressure plate module. The circuit board is first pressed onto the fixture rotation module of the third station using the fixture pressure plate module, and then the circuit board is milled from bottom to top using the lower milling module.
4. A multi-station rotary PCB separator, mainly characterized in that: the PCB separator is equipped with a divider, the divider is equipped with a turret, the turret is surrounded by four hollowed-out and equally spaced jig rotating modules, the jig rotating modules can be used to place the circuit board to be cut, the divider synchronously rotates the four jig rotating modules to form four stations that can operate simultaneously, the first station is the feeding module, the second station is the milling module, the third station is the self-contained cutting and inspection module, and the fourth station is the discharging module.
5. The multi-station rotary PCB separator as described in claim 4, wherein: The second station's milling module is a combination of an upper milling module and a lower milling module. The upper milling module is equipped with a fixture pressure plate module and a transfer module. First, the fixture pressure plate module is used to press the circuit board onto the fixture rotation module of the second station, and then the upper milling module and the lower milling module are used to mill the circuit board.
6. A multi-station rotary PCB separator as described in claim 1 or 4, wherein: The feeding module is equipped with a feeding transmission module and a feeding pick-up module. The feeding transmission module and the feeding pick-up module are used to place the circuit board to be milled onto the fixture rotation module of a station.
7. A multi-station rotary PCB separator as described in claim 1 or 4, wherein: The discharge module is equipped with a discharge transmission module and a discharge pick-up module. The milled circuit board is placed into the fixture rotation module of the four stations using the discharge transmission module and the discharge pick-up module.
8. A multi-station rotary PCB separator as described in claim 1 or 4, wherein: The milling module is equipped with a chip discharge module.
